1994 Softball NCAA Championship Team

1994 Softball Team HOF
     Explosive, record-shattering team that posted a 64-3 record and went undefeated in the College World Series to capture UA's Second straight NCAA title and its third in four years. Outscored the opposition 527-100 and won 23 games via "mercy rule." Hit 93 home runs as a team, with Laura Espinoza hitting 30, both new NCAA marks by wide margins. Amy Chellevold batted .404 for the season and pitcher Susie Parra won 33 games. A record seven Wildcats--- Leah Braatz, Chellevold, Jenny Dalton, Nancy Evans, Laura Espinoza, Leah O'Brien and Parra were named First Team All-Pac-10. Parra was Pac-10 player of the Year and Braatz was Pac-10 Newcomer of the Year. Braatz, Chellevold, Dalton, Espinoza, O'Brien and parra were named All-America. Mike Candrea was Pac-10 and Regional Coach of the Year. 
Roster: Leah Braatz, Amy Chellevold, Jenny Dalton, Carrie Dolan, Andrea Doty, Susie Duarte, Laura Espinoza, Nancy Evans, Krista Gomez, Michelle Martinez, Leah O'Brien, Susie Parra, Brandi Shriver, Valerie Zepeda
